3.1.3.2
DIGITAL FREQUENCY REFERENCE
About the digital frequency reference, there are two working modes can be selected with C09:
Setting C09 = 1 a reference can be provided with an encoder signal with 4 tracks of a
o
maximum range varying between 5V and 24V and a maximum frequency of 300KHz.
Setting C09 = 2 a speed reference can be provided with an frequency signal with a
o
maximum range varying between 5V and 24V and a maximum frequency of 300KHz.
(setting C09 =3 will be manage the same input, but internally will be count only rising edge,
this option is useful only if it is used the time decode)
The number N of impulses/revolution for the reference is set by connection C220:
N
N° of impulses/revolution
There are the parameters P221 and P222 that permit specification of the ratio between the reference
speed and input frequency as a Numerator/Denominator ratio.
In general terms, therefore, if you want the speed of rotation of the rotor to be X rpm, the relationship
to use to determine the input frequency is the following:
Let us now look at a few examples of cascade activation (MASTER SLAVE) with frequency input
according to a standard encoder.
By a MASTER drive the simulated encoder signals A,/A,B,/B are picked up to be taken to the
frequency input of the SLAVE. By means of parameters P221 and P222 the slipping between the
two is programmed.
